
Three Seriously Injured in Head-on Collision at Berenga, CCTV Captures Crash
Three young men were seriously injured after a motorcycle and a scooter collided head-on at Berenga in Silchar on Friday (July 31). The accident reportedly occurred when one of the riders attempted to avoid a pothole on the damaged road, causing the vehicles to lose control and crash into each other.
According to local residents, all three injured riders sustained serious injuries in the collision. People nearby rushed to the spot, rescued the victims and immediately shifted them to a hospital for treatment.
Hospital sources said all three are currently undergoing treatment in critical condition. One of the injured, identified as Junaid Ahmed, is said to be in an extremely critical condition and has been admitted to the Intensive Care Unit (ICU).
The impact of the collision was captured on a CCTV camera installed at a roadside shop. The footage shows the motorcycle and the scooter approaching from opposite directions at high speed before colliding head-on. Within moments, local residents gathered at the scene and rushed to help the injured.
